Why Most Campers Get Cold (And How to Fix It)
The physics of cold-weather camping is simple: your body generates heat, and the environment steals it through conduction, convection, and radiation. When sleeping on frozen ground without proper insulation, conductive heat loss can be overwhelming—the earth acts as a massive heat sink. Our cold weather camping safety principles emphasize that mastering this heat equation is non-negotiable. The solution lies in creating a multi-layered barrier that traps warm air and blocks the cold from all directions, including from below, which is often the most neglected aspect.
Many beginners mistakenly believe a heavy sleeping bag solves everything. In reality, even a high-quality winter sleeping bag compresses under body weight, losing its loft and insulating power beneath you. This is why the sleeping pad is arguably more critical than the bag itself. A complete sleep system integrates a high R-value pad, a temperature-appropriate bag, and smart clothing choices to manage moisture and maximize thermal efficiency.

1. The Sleeping Pad: Your Primary Defense Against the Ground
R-value measures a pad's resistance to heat flow—the higher the number, the better it insulates. For cold weather, aim for an R-value of at least 5.0. In extreme cold (below 10°F), combine a closed-cell foam pad (R-value ~2.0) with an insulated inflatable pad (R-value ~4.0+) to achieve a combined R-value of 6.0 or higher. This system is lightweight, redundant, and prevents catastrophic heat loss if your inflatable pad fails. 2. The Sleeping Bag: Understanding Temperature Ratings
The EN/ISO comfort rating indicates the lowest temperature at which a "standard woman" can sleep comfortably. The lower limit rating is for a "standard man" curled up. Always choose a bag rated 10–15°F lower than the expected nighttime low. For true winter camping, a bag with a comfort rating of 0°F or lower is essential. Down insulation offers the best warmth-to-weight ratio and compressibility but must be kept dry. Synthetic insulation retains warmth when damp and is more affordable, making it a practical choice for damp climates or when you're just starting to explore winter camping. Remember that wearing too many layers inside your bag can compress the insulation and reduce its effectiveness—a lightweight base layer and a warm hat are often the best combination.
3. The Tent: Four-Season Shelter and Ventilation
A dedicated 4-season tent is not just a marketing term—it features stronger poles to handle snow loads, steeper walls to shed snow, and solid fabric panels to block spindrift. Crucially, they have adjustable ventilation to manage condensation. The biggest mistake campers make is sealing every vent to stay warm; this traps breath moisture, which freezes on the inner tent walls and rains down as frost inside. Preparing Your Body and Your Camp
Gear alone won't guarantee warmth. Your personal habits and campsite selection play an enormous role. Arriving at camp cold, dehydrated, or with wet clothing is a recipe for a miserable night. Drink a warm, non-caffeinated beverage and eat a high-fat, high-protein snack like nuts or cheese right before bed. This fuels your metabolic furnace through the night. Avoid alcohol—it dilates blood vessels, causing rapid heat loss despite the initial warm feeling.
Site selection is equally critical. Cold air sinks, so avoid setting up your tent in the bottom of a valley or a depression where a cold air pocket will form. Instead, find a sheltered spot slightly elevated, perhaps behind a natural windbreak like a dense stand of trees or a large rock. Ensure your tent is pitched tautly to minimize flapping and heat loss from wind. Placing a camping tarp as a footprint and an additional barrier inside the tent can provide an extra layer against ground cold and moisture. Backpacking: Every ounce counts. An ultralight down bag rated to 0°F paired with a high-R-value inflatable pad is the standard. The layering clothing approach described in our winter layering system is critical, as your mid-layers and puffy jacket become part of your sleep system, allowing you to carry a lighter sleeping bag. A two-person tent can be warmer than a solo shelter due to shared body heat, but also generates more condensation—ventilation becomes even more vital.
Pro Tip: The Vapor Barrier Liner (VBL): In sustained sub-zero conditions, a vapor barrier liner worn inside your sleeping bag prevents sweat from entering the bag's insulation, where it would freeze and degrade loft night after night. Morning After: Managing Condensation and Packing Up
Waking up to a frost-covered interior is normal in cold weather, but how you handle it determines your comfort for the next night. Shake frost off your sleeping bag and tent walls outside before it warms and melts into liquid water. If the sun is out, drape your sleeping bag over a bush or rock to dry, even for just 15 minutes. Finally, always have a backup plan. Knowing the signs of hypothermia—uncontrollable shivering, confusion, drowsiness—is essential. If conditions deteriorate beyond what your gear can handle, don't hesitate to retreat to your vehicle or break camp. No summit or destination is worth a cold-weather injury.
